The cache is computed on demand and From 3b5ca32b5f24a288a84b2ae9dc755404ad90f5cc Mon Sep 17 00:00:00 2001 From: Patrick Steinhardt Date: Tue, 10 Mar 2026 16:18:23 +0100 Subject: [PATCH 3/6] object-file: extract logic to approximate object count In "builtin/gc.c" we have some logic that checks whether we need to repack objects. This is done by counting the number of objects that we have and checking whether it exceeds a certain threshold. We don't really need an accurate object count though, which is why we only open a single object diretcroy shard and then extrapolate from there. Extract this logic into a new function that is owned by the loose object database source. This is done to prepare for a subsequent change, where we'll introduce object counting on the object database source level.
